The closure of a popular waterfront pub has been an emotional experience for the woman who it was named for.
āThe people that have bought the building donāt want the business,ā said co-owner Rose Sexsmith, who choked back tears, when discussing the permanent closure of Roseās Waterfront Pub, located at 1352 Water St.
āIt is what it is. Weāve been incredibly blessed. Itās the time, Iām grateful for all these years.ā
The pub will be closing Sept. 30 and Sexsmith said its ānew owners donāt want to run Roseās the way it isā and she has no idea what their plans are.
Despite the tears, Sexsmith is excited about the future.
āItās bittersweet. All those things, Iām sad about my staff⦠and Iām sad because itās like your kid is moving to another world,ā she said. āWeāve had an amazing run and met amazing people. I canāt say how wonderful itās been.ā
Sexsmith has co-owned the pub with her brother George Hanna, since 1989, which she described as āa successful partnership.ā Her children have also worked at the pub and her grandchildren are now old enough to sit and enjoy a drink on its deck.
General manager Andrew Neville said it came as a little bit of a shock for the staff. He also is unable to discuss details for the future plans of the building.
The popular pub operates as both a pub and nightclub and according to its website, āRoseās is the only true waterfront pub in Āé¶¹AV.ā

The pub has been operating employs 58 workers, including some seasonal staff, Neville said.
āWeād just like to thank all the people of Āé¶¹AV for supporting us,ā he said.
